Ragnarok Biological Weapon Quest

Advertisement

The Ragnarok Biological Weapon Quest is the continuation of the Ragnarok Weapon Quest. Both requires medicine to cure the characters in this quest. This quest has a love and friendship story and all somehow ended well. It has higher base experience reward than the medicine quest. It only requires you to travel from one town to another using the Airship. It requires a lot of items but not difficult to find.


Level Requirement:
60
Item Requirements:

Quest Prerequisite: Medicine Quest

Reward: 1,200,000 Base Experience

Ragnarok Biological Weapon Quest

1. Take the Airship from Juno then go to Einbroch. Talk to Morriphen (ein_in01 16 36) inside the Einbroch Blacksmith Guild (einbroch 255 108). He’s sick and he needs your help. He’ll ask you to get his medicine from his wife Siria in Hugel.

2. Take the Airship again then go to Hugel. Siria (hu_in01 326 307) is at the second floor inside a house in Hugel(147 216). Tell her about his husband Morriphen. Apparently, she runs out of medicine so you have to get some from Dono is sick. You’ll learned that Siria too is sick.

3. Go to Lighthalzen and at the lower left side, you could find Dono (lighthalzen 88 79). He’s going to need a lot of items in order to create the medicine that Morriphen and Siria needs. He requires 5 Coal, 5 Brigan, 5 Cyfar, 1 Unripe Apple, 3 Detrimindexta, 20 Shell, 1 Red Herb, 1 Blue Herb, 1 Green Herb, 1 White Herb, 1 Yellow Herb. He’ll mix these items but later on finds out that he needs something more. He needs a Red Plant Stem Powder that you could get from Makkie.

4. Makkie (lhz_in03 193 28) is inside the bar (lighthalzen 345 229) in the Lighthalzen slums area (lighthalzen 267 200).

5. Return to Dono and give him the powder. Dono has now successfully made the medicine.

6. Go back to Einbroch again and give the medicine to Morriphen. He’ll get better and then he’ll ask you to give the same medicine for his wife Siria

7. Go to Hugel and give the medicine to Siria. Siria would thank you for your help and give you 500,000 Base exp

8. Go back to Einbroch again and talk to Morriphen. You’ll ask him to tell you the story between him, Siria and Dono. How the three of them are connected. He would gladly do so because of your help. After he finishes his story, you’ll get 700,000 base exp. Talk to him again to hear the ‘happily ever after’ news.
